Characteristics of Duplex Board with Grey Back


Duplex board is a type of paperboard that is manufactured using both mechanical and chemical pulping processes. The duplex term signifies that the board has two layers a white top surface and a grey back. The white side is designed to provide excellent print quality, making it ideal for high-resolution graphics and vibrant colors. The grey back adds strength and rigidity, making it suitable for packaging heavy products. Furthermore, duplex board is typically lightweight, which aids in reducing shipping costs while maintaining structural integrity.


Applications of Duplex Board with Grey Back


Exporters often find duplex board with grey back in a variety of industries. One of its primary uses is in packaging, particularly for consumer goods such as food products, pharmaceuticals, and electronics. The board is also utilized in the production of boxes, tags, labels, and other printed materials.


1. Food Packaging Due to its good barrier properties, duplex board is commonly used for packaging food items. It can be coated to increase its resistance to moisture and grease, making it a suitable choice for perishable goods.


2. Pharmaceuticals The medical industry demands high standards for packaging materials to ensure safety and compliance. Duplex board with grey back meets these requirements, providing a protective barrier for pharmaceuticals.


3. Electronics The electronics sector relies on duplex board for packaging delicate items that require additional protection during transport and storage. The strength of the grey back provides the necessary support for heavier products.


4. Printing The smooth surface of the white side makes it easy for printers to produce high-quality images and text, making duplex board a favorite among graphic designers and marketers.
